Job title: Senior Scientist – Chemical Process Development
Location: Sisteron
About the job
As Senior Scientist, Chemical Process Development within our MSAT (Manufacturing Sciences, Analytics and Technology) team, you'll contribute to the industrialization of Sanofi's future pipeline and secure industrial performance through process development, technical support, and innovation. Main responsibilities:
Develop and optimize chemical processes for new molecule launches through hands-on laboratory experiments, working under fume hood in strict compliance with HSE and GMP standards
Support industrial technology transfers from development to commercial production, collaborating with CMC, site teams, and global MSAT networks
Provide technical expertise to resolve production issues, conduct deviation investigations, and propose solutions for batch recovery
Drive continuous improvement by optimizing existing processes and participating in supplier qualification programs (MSEP)
Mentor junior scientists and technicians on laboratory techniques, process development methodologies, and safety practices
Communicate effectively with management and cross-functional teams through reports, presentations, and technical committees
Ensure rigorous documentation of experiments and results in electronic laboratory notebooks (ELN)
About you
Experience: Hands-on experience in organic synthesis and laboratory-scale chemical process development; familiarity with process industrialization, scale-up studies, and GMP environments is highly valued
Soft and technical skills:
Strong foundation in organic chemistry (reactions, extraction, crystallization, distillation);
Proficiency in analytical techniques (TLC, HPLC, NMR, GC)
Customer-oriented mindset with agility to switch between priorities
Team spirit and ability to mentor others
Proactive problem-solving approach
Education: PhD in organic chemistry or chemical engineering strongly preferred; Master's degree or Engineering degree (Bac+5) in relevant scientific discipline with significant experience will also be considered
Languages: French (mandatory for daily operations); English (good level required for international collaboration and scientific documentation)

No black box, no LLM guesswork: a deterministic score built from four normalized attributes. Here's this role's own peer group at different match levels, so you can see the mechanism, not just the result.
Every comparison starts from the same 100-point budget: 25 for working in the same function, 40 for the same therapeutic area, 20 for the same or adjacent seniority, 15 for the same country. A dimension we can't confirm on both sides contributes nothing, never a guess, never a free pass.
0 points, never a partial guess. A role we know almost nothing about beyond its function bottoms out at 25%; it never inflates to 100% just because there's little to compare against. Seniority uses a defined ladder (Associate → Manager → Associate Director → Senior → Principal → Director → Senior Director → Executive/VP) so "Director" and "Senior Director" count as adjacent, but "Director" and "Executive/VP" do not.
